Hi all,

Over the last 2 years I have recorded NES, SNES, and Nintendo 64 video game footage onto VHS tapes. Now, when I import the NES and SNES footage into iMovie via my DAC-100 converter, the video skips a few frames every other second so that the footage is basically unwatchable. When I play the tapes in my VCR, though, they play fine. The N64 footage came out perfectly in iMovie, but the NES and SNES footage is all cut up.

Any thoughts on remedies to this problem? Thanks.
